Job Description
As we approach the next phase of our growth as an organization, we are looking for a dynamic and conscientious Finance Manager to join our rapidly scaling team. As you’ll be the first permanent person in this position, you’ll have the exciting opportunity to help shape the Finance function from scratch and determine how it interacts with the rest of the company.
What you’ll be doing
- Core support for all financial accounting, reporting and strategic planning
- Work closely with our Operations team to put in place scalable processes, systems, and communications
- Together with our outsourced partners, complete all the day-to-day tasks required for running the business
- Assist our CFO in our financial planning process and support all fundraising activities
- Maintain global financial controls, manage risk, and assist the setting policy
- Ensure the organisation is benefitting from all relevant start-up financing and COVID-19 support available for business
- Coordinate Finance-related suppliers and systems
- Support Operations in the management of payroll, expenses and pensions
- Optimize our currency use to minimise costs
Requirements
- Finance Manager or equivalent in a successful company with international operations, specifically UK and Canada would be a bonus
- Ideally have experience raising start-up finance
- Be both hands-on with both balance sheet and commercial accounting, while maintaining sight of the big picture
- The ability to identify (and implement) the key metrics which underpin a world-class SaaS model scale-up company
- Well-presented with outstanding communication skills
- Technically astute and accomplished, and capable of identifying and operating the most advanced global financial and accounting systems
- Experience in start-up or early-stage company or a background operating in an entrepreneurial environment including involvement in strategic direction preferred
- A passion for effective (but pragmatic) cost management
Benefits
- Salary in the range of £35,000 to £50,000 per year, depending on experience, plus share option package
- DC Pension Plan
- 25 days annual leave, plus bank holidays and your birthday
- International travel opportunities
- A home office budget to get you set-up while working remotely
- Training budget to help you develop in your role, including access to MasterClass
We are willing to consider part-time applications for this role.
